At the beginning of each school/seminary year I hand out a survey to my students.  It's different every year.  I ask all kinds of random questions, about themselves, favorite things, families, hobbies, etc.  
   
  I use this survey during the year to arrange them in groups (I change them every two weeks).  For instance;  the three groups might be, 1) those that like sugared cereal, 2) those that like healthier cereal, and 3) those that prefer hot cereal (this, from their response to:  What kind of cereal do you prefer in the morning). Another time the three groups might be 1) those whose fav. scripture is in the Bible, 2) fav. scripture is in the Book of Mormon, or 3) fav. scripture is in the Doc. and Cov.. Another example is 1) those who like chocolate w/nuts 2) chocolate w.o./nuts or 3) don't like chocolate.  You get the idea!
   
  I have put them into groups in alphabetical order according to their middle names, or the last letter of their names, or birth order, or how many letters are in their full names, etc., etc..  
   
  Here's the fun part, I offer bonus points (or sem. bucks, or beans, whatever our current incentive is), to the first group that can figure out why they are in the same group.  This way they try to get to know each other and work together, they are always curious to find out why they are together.  We spend very little time in class discussing their guesses.  They are allowed to ask yes or no questions before seminary starts. There is more discussion after class in the foyer as they try to find out why they are grouped together.  
   
  One time they were grouped according to their pets.  1- dogs, 2- cats, 3- other or none.  They could not figure it out.  I told them I would give them a big fat hint each day, but they would have to pay attention.  One day I just barked right out loud while they were doing some writing.  The next day I meowed in the middle of my lesson.  It took a few days and they finally figured it out.  
   
  I love to have JOY in Seminary and this is one way that we do that and work toward being a zion class.
